Getting there & planning your visit

To visit the Ash-cum-Ridley War Memorial, the nearest railway station is Longfield, located 4.4 km away. The postcode for the memorial is TN15 7HB, and entry is free.

Heritage listing

Details MATERIALS: granite DESCRIPTION: Ash-cum-Ridley memorial comprises an obelisk on a square plinth which is set upon a single-stepped base. The plinth is polished with inscribed faces. The First World War inscription faces the road and reads: TO THE GLORY OF GOD/ AND IN LASTING MEMORY OF/ THE MEN OF THIS PARISH/ WHO FELL IN THE GREAT WAR 1914 - 1919/ (NAMES)/ TRUE LOVE BY LIFE,/ TRUE LOVE, BY DEATH, IS TRIED./ LIVE THOU FOR ENGLAND/ WE FOR ENGLAND DIED. The Second World War inscription was added to the eastern face: 1939 - 1945/ (NAMES). This List entry has been amended to add the source for War Memorials Register.
